Amazon Web Services (AWS) is seeking an experienced finance leader to join its North America Enterprise Sales Finance team. This is an exciting opportunity to become a part of one of the most dynamic and fastest growing organizations at Amazon. The role will work closely with business and finance stakeholders to support and drive one of the largest and most complex North America businesses in AWS. The candidate will be responsible for analyzing and forecasting topline trends to monitor state of the business health deepdiving variances to uncover operating insights collaborating on strategic investment decisions to optimize financial returns establishing/enhancing governance mechanisms and driving planning and forecasting rhythms. Successful candidates will have a high degree of intellectual curiosity a passion for uncovering insights to drive business outcomes at scale the ability to influence senior stakeholders via strong written and verbal communication skills and the capacity to prioritize effectively while dealing with ambiguity.
Key job responsibilities
Collaborate with senior business stakeholders on revenue and strategy investment decisions that balance growth objectives with financial returns
Invent and design scalable detailed reporting to monitor the business and financial health
Deep dive drivers of monthly & quarterly variances in revenue & expense metrics and provide key insights to business stakeholders to inform operating strategies
Own planning and forecasting for NAMER Enterprise business and influence business stakeholders to ensure initiatives and any get to green plans are aligned with broader organizational objectives
Develop and implement governance mechanisms to protect AWS investments
Perform adhoc analyses to help business leaders solve complex problems and understand financial implications
